Missing women techie from Hyd traced in Pune by Cyberabad police

| @indiablooms | Jan 15, 2020, at 11:29 pm

Hyderabad/UNI: The Cyberabad police on Wednesday successfully traced missing woman techie Rohita from Hyderabad, at Pune city in Maharashtra.

The 35-year-old IT employee, who resides in Gachibowli Police station limited, went missing since Dec 22 last year.

Since her missing, Cyberabad police formed eight special teams to trace her, police said here.

In spite of all-odds, Cyberabad police along with Pune police successfully traced the Hyderabad techie woman.

Efforts were being made to bring her to Hyderabad, police added.
